Câlnic is a locality located in Vest, Romania. Câlnic is known for its historical landmarks, including the Câlnic Castle, which attracts tourists from all over. From a cyclist’s perspective, Câlnic offers decent cycling routes on its surrounding roads, providing opportunities for road and gravel cycling. While there are no famous cycling-related spots or well-known climbs directly in Câlnic, the castle and the surrounding beautiful landscapes make it an interesting base for cyclists to explore the region and enjoy a mix of culture and nature.

This 45-kilometer long gravel route takes you on an exploration of the wilderness near Câlnic. With an ascent of 504 meters, this route offers a moderate challenge suitable for amateur cyclists. The epicness of this route is rated 2, as it offers a peaceful and tranquil experience in the unspoiled nature. The highlights along the route include the scenic Poiana Coltan, the charming town of Ezeriș, and the stunning Tâlva Mare II. Each highlight is scored based on its attractiveness, with the highest score being 5. Poiana Coltan receives a score of 2 due to its peaceful surroundings and natural beauty, while Ezeriș and Tâlva Mare II score a 4 for their cultural significance and stunning landscapes.

With a total distance of 135 kilometers and an ascent of 880 meters, this road cycling route is perfect for road cycling enthusiasts seeking scenic views of Vest Romania. The difficulty level of this route is 3, suitable for well-trained amateurs. The epicness of this route is rated 3, as it offers beautiful landscapes and interesting attractions along the way. The highlights along the route include the iconic Câlnic, the stunning Tâlva Mare II, the charming Buzias, the picturesque Fârliug, the historic Ezeriș, and the breathtaking Govândari. Each highlight is scored based on its attractiveness, with the highest score being 5. Câlnic, Tâlva Mare II, Buzias, Fârliug, Ezeriș, and Govândari all receive a score of 4 for their scenic beauty and cultural significance.
